Cohen, Melanie Rovner was born on August 9, 1944 in Chicago, Illinois, United States. Daughter of Millard Jack and Sheila (Fox) Rovner.

Brandeis University (Bachelor of Arts, with honors, 1965). De Paul University (Juris Doctor, magna cum laude, 1977).
Worked at Altheimer & Gray (Chicago, Illinois) specializing in Bankruptcy, Reorganization, Secured Lending. Admitted to the bar, 1977, Illinois. Frequent Lecturer and Author of numerous Published Articles.
Instructor, John Marshall Law School, 1995. Law Clerk to The Honorable Frederick J. Hertz, Bankruptcy Judge, United States. District Court, Northern District of Illinois, 1976-1977.
Member: Chicago (Chairman, Committee on Bankruptcy and Reorganization, 1983), Illinois State and American (Co-Chairman, Committee on Enforcement of Creditors' Rights) Bar Associations. Commercial Law League of America. Illinois Trial Lawyers Association.
Turnaround Management Association (National and Chicago Director, Chicago President). Bankruptcy Arbitration and Mediation Services (Director).
Member American Bar Association(co-chair commission on enforcement of creditors' rights and bankruptcy), Illinois State Bar Association, Chicago Bar Association (chairman bankruptcy reorganization committee 1983-1985), Commercial Law League, Illinois Trial Lawyers Association, Commercial Finance Association Education Foundation (Board of Governors), Turnaround Management Association (president Chicago/midwest chapter 1990-1992, national board directors 1990.
Married Arthur Wieber Cohen, February 17, 1968. Children: Mitchell Jay, Jennifer Sue.
